Nvidia has confirmed that it will launch its portable games device Project Shield on June 27 for $299.

The new price is a little lower than the expected $349, a response to press and player reaction, according to Nvidia.

Shield intends to bring home console-grade visuals and controls to the portable space, and is capable of playing both Android and PC titles. It was revealed at CES in January and was pitched by Nvidia as having the potential to “do for games what the iPod and Kindle have done for music and books.”
